Can anyone provide the center-to-center distances (pivot to pivot) for the upper and lower dogleg links on 53-57 hood hinges, please? Thanks in advance.

Re: '53-'57 Hood Hinges
Roy, I have your instructions but still have a problem. The inner support is not aligned with the hood opening, or to put it another way, with the outer skin all nice and tidy in the opening, the left rear latch pin is off by about 1/4 inch and the hinge links are bent (offset) about 1/4 inch to the right. If hinges are made correct, the hood won't close into the opening, so I'm considering splitting the outer skin from the support, making everything fit correctly then putting the skin back on. That's why I want to confirm the center-to-center dimensions to verify where I should be when I'm done. Lots of work to fix a factory condition.

Re: '53-'57 Hood Hinges
Rod, A-C = 2 7/8", B-D = 3 9/16~5/8" (might be 19/32 but didn't use a caliper). Gary....NCRS Texas Chapter
